Postal Service / Mail Room Worker jobs in Buncombe, North Carolina involve sorting and distributing mail, operating mail processing equipment, and assisting with package shipments. Workers must handle incoming and outgoing mail efficiently and accurately, ensuring timely delivery to the correct recipients. Postal Service / Mail Room Workers in Buncombe, North Carolina handle mail sorting and distribution within the postal service or office setting. - Entry-level Mail Room Clerk salaries range from $25,000 to $30,000 per year - Mid-career Postal Service Worker salaries range from $30,000 to $35,000 per year - Senior-level Mail Room Supervisor salaries range from $35,000 to $40,000 per year The history of postal service workers in Buncombe, North Carolina dates back to the early days of mail delivery in the region, where mail was transported by horse-drawn carriages and later by trains. As the population grew, so did the demand for efficient mail services, leading to the establishment of dedicated postal service workers in the area. Over time, the role of postal service workers has evolved to include not only mail sorting and distribution but also customer service, package handling, and logistics coordination. With advancements in technology, postal service workers now utilize automated sorting machines and digital tracking systems to streamline mail processing and delivery. Current trends in the postal service industry in Buncombe, North Carolina include a focus on sustainability and eco-friendly practices, such as using electric vehicles for mail delivery and implementing paperless billing options. Additionally, postal service workers are adapting to the rise of e-commerce by handling an increasing volume of packages and ensuring timely delivery to customers.
